Mathewrichard99: South Africa has effectively functioned as a shock absorber for the rest of the continents, a spare tyre other African nations could lean on whenever decades of poor leadership pushed their citizens to flee. Since apartheid ended, that role has meant absorbing a steady, largely unregulated flow of migrants from countries whose governments failed to provide security, jobs, or basic services at home.
The problem is that this absorption has come at a cost the South African state never really budgeted for. Infrastructure built for a smaller population, housing, clinics, schools, electricity, water, is now stretched past its limits, and ordinary South Africans are the ones feeling the strain in longer queues, higher competition for scarce jobs, and crumbling services. That's arguably the real engine behind the anger and the xenophobic backlash: it's less about hostility to fellow Africans in the abstract and more about a population that feels it has been carrying a continental burden alone, with no relief and no acknowledgment. The demand, then, isn't really "leave and disappear" , it's "go fix your own house." The underlying argument is that migrants would be better served putting that same energy, skill, and labor into pressuring their own governments for accountability, rather than exporting the problem southward indefinitely. In that view, the sustainable fix isn't tighter borders in South Africa alone , it's functional states elsewhere on the continent, so people have a reason to stay and build rather than leave and survive. That's more of the reasons that migrants are frequently scapegoated for problems such as, unemployment, crime, service delivery failures , that are substantially rooted in South Africa's own domestic policy choices and inequality legacy, not migration levels. Xenophobic violence has killed and displaced people, including migrants with legal status and even South African citizens mistaken for foreigners, which is a harder thing to justify as pure economic frustration. nicely written
